The Think Differently Database Act, which mandates the creation of a comprehensive national resource database for individuals with disabilities and their families, was signed into law by President Joe Biden on January 4, 2025. This bill aims to be a game-changer by centralizing essential information on government benefits, Medicaid waivers, Social Security (SSI/SSDI), and other planning resources into one accessible platform.

The database could significantly reduce the challenges many families face when searching for answers and resources regarding disability related topics. While there is no official timeline for the launch, this legislation marks a major step in the right direction in ensuring that individuals with disabilities, caregivers, and families across the country can find the resources and support they need.
